For a single, all current loan forgiveness programs, such as Public Service Loan Forgiveness, income-driven repayment plans and Teacher Loan Forgiveness, are limited to federal student loans. Even the military student loan repayment help program is limited to federal loans. Income-driven repayment plans (IDRs) are readily available to borrowers with direct federal student loans primarily based on revenue level. They offer you debt forgiveness, but they differ drastically from Public Service Loan Forgiveness and other programs simply because the borrower has to spend taxes on the quantity of debt that’s forgiven at the finish.

Consolidating your loans can potentially influence your eligibility for specific student loan forgiveness applications. If you consolidate federal student loans through a Direct Consolidation Loan, it creates a new loan, and the terms of forgiveness applications may possibly reset. In addition, if you refinance to a private lender, they may not present the very same forgiveness choices. The student loan forgiveness referenced in Biden’s e mail was provided via the IDR Account Adjustment initiative. This one-time program was implemented to address longstanding problems with earnings-driven repayment plans such as poor record-keeping and forbearance steering.
